Output efbd834a1a2dd2bcd91c86f660938b7bcbef252236da0464a89cc53cf8a769d1:0

value
91812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c114832050efba0e5a5cd27097886872d90c783d OP_EQUAL
address
3KHvunDpf9svCRhgZqDYJdaJNU2mk8XfYz
transaction
efbd834a1a2dd2bcd91c86f660938b7bcbef252236da0464a89cc53cf8a769d1
confirmations
282823
spent
true